At Communication 101: Kids Style, our mission is to equip children with the tools to communicate effectively, build meaningful relationships, and develop confidence in who
they are. Through fun, engaging activities like sports, arts, music, and teamwork, we teach kids how to express themselves, resolve conflict, and care about others. We are passionate about helping kids grow into respectful, confident individuals who know how to connect, listen, and lead.
Communication 101: Kids Style is a high-energy, interactive camp designed to help kids learn communication, teamwork, respect, and confidence in a fun and engaging way.
Through sports, arts and crafts, music, games, and group activities, kids naturally learn how to work together, express themselves, and navigate real-life situations.
This is not just a sit-and-talk camp—kids are learning through doing. Whether they are building something, playing a game, or working as a team, every activity is designed to teach important life skills in a way that feels fun and natural.

Kindness counts!
Kids will get tokens on the first day at registration. Throughout the camp, they will be able to give out and earn tokens for being kind and helpful to their peers and camp leaders. On the last day of camp they will be able to buy things in the store with their tokens!! So fun!!

About Communication 101: Kids Style
Founder of Communication 101: Kids Style Shelly Thorne has spent over 10 years working with kids as a volleyball coach, youth group leader, and mentor. She has also been a dance instructor, lifeguard, and swim instructor, giving her a wide range of experience working with children of all ages.
For five years, Shelly trained in communication and personal development through Frontier Trainings in San Diego under Clinton Swain. These trainings focused on communication, conflict resolution, personal growth, and building stronger relationships.
Through her experiences, Shelly saw a consistent need—kids often struggle with communication, empathy, and thinking about others. This inspired her to create Communication 101: Kids Style, a camp designed to help kids learn these essential skills early in life in a fun, engaging way.
